Dealing with FHA Loan Delinquencies: A Guide to Recovery
Falling behind on your FHA loan payments can create significant anxiety, and it's crucial to take action as soon as possible. Thankfully, there are several options available to help you recover. First, contact your loan servicer immediately. They can provide information about potential forbearance that may be able to minimize your monthly payments or grant a temporary pause on payments.
You should also research other assistance programs. The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) offers support to homeowners facing financial problems. Additionally, some non-profit organizations provide low-cost housing counseling services. Remember, the sooner you address late payments, the more manageable it will be to correct the situation and avoid more serious consequences.
